Compare all specifications:

2007 Honda Accord 2009 Mercedes-Benz C
Make Honda Mercedes-Benz
Model Accord C
Year Released 2007 2009
Body Type Sedan Station Wagon
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 2353 cc 2148 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Valves per Cylinder 4 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 166 HP 168 HP
Engine RPM 5800 RPM 3800 RPM
Torque 217 Nm 400 Nm
Torque RPM 4000 RPM 2000 RPM
Engine Bore Size 87 mm 88.1 mm
Engine Stroke Size 99 mm 88.3 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 9.7:1 17.5:1
Drive Type Front Rear
Transmission Type Automatic Manual
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 5 doors
Vehicle Weight 1990 kg 1630 kg
Vehicle Length 4860 mm 4600 mm
Vehicle Width 1830 mm 1780 mm
Vehicle Height 1460 mm 1470 mm
Wheelbase Size 2750 mm 2770 mm
Fuel Consumption Overall 8.4 L/100km 6.1 L/100km
Fuel Tank Capacity 65 L 66 L
